Mission Statement

The Sanitation Control Procedures (SCP) Redesign Workgroup aims to create an interactive training group that permits trainees to engage in the training content and recognize the importance of sanitation in seafood processing facilities.

Workgroup Responsibilities & Duties

  • Develop a Course Design document that includes all program modules.
  • Develop module content and exercises to include in the training program.
  • Provide usable record-keeping templates for industry participants.
  • Identify accessible resources.
